Let the Fire Burn

Submitted by Jason Olshefsky @ JayceLand.com on Thu, 2014-01-02 18:43

original article: http://jayceland.com/blog/archive/2013/12/08/let-the-fire-burn/

 

I got to see Let the Fire Burn at the Little on November 12. It's been a while, but I did want to give it a bit of a review.

It's an impressive document of the misguided actions of the Philadelphia government and police against the MOVE organization that led to them bombing and burning a house in 1985 containing 13 members, eleven of whom perished. In a way, it's a microcosm of war: both are avoidable, expensive, and deadly acts.

"The Throwaways": discussion after the screening

Submitted by SusanGalloway on Sat, 2013-12-21 01:37

"The Throwaways": Discussion after Screening

Rochester had the honor of screening the film "The Throwaways", which documents the life of Ira McKinley, an ex-felon and homeless man as he attempts to show the viewer "the throwaways" in our society.

Occupy Wall Street and Anarchism

Submitted by Rochester Red & Black on Thu, 2013-12-19 18:42

original article: http://rocredandblack.org/occupy-wall-street-and-anarchism/

 

Occupy Wall Street and Anarchism

 

On September 29th, Rochester Red & Black hosted a discussion about the influences that Anarchist ideals had on the Occupy Wall Street Movement. The talk was led by two authors that have recently written on the subject, Mark Bray and Nathan Schneider.
